Heim >Backend-Entwicklung >PHP-Tutorial >Wie führe ich UNION-Abfragen mithilfe des aktiven Datensatzes von CodeIgniter aus?

Wie führe ich UNION-Abfragen mithilfe des aktiven Datensatzes von CodeIgniter aus?

Linda Hamilton
Linda HamiltonOriginal
2024-11-15 09:49:02676Durchsuche

How to Execute UNION Queries Using CodeIgniter's Active Record?

UNION-Abfragen im Active Record-Muster von CodeIgniter

Während der Active Record von CodeIgniter eine bequeme Möglichkeit zum Ausführen von Datenbankabfragen bietet, fehlt ihm die native Unterstützung für UNION-Abfragen. Diese Einschränkung kann jedoch mit einem benutzerdefinierten Abfrageansatz überwunden werden.

Verwendung benutzerdefinierter Abfragen

Um eine UNION-Abfrage mithilfe des aktiven Datensatzes von CodeIgniter durchzuführen, müssen Sie die Abfragezeichenfolge manuell schreiben und dann die Abfrage verwenden Methode:

$this->db->query('SELECT column_name(s) FROM table_name1 UNION SELECT column_name(s) FROM table_name2');

Diese Abfrage führt die UNION-Operation aus und gibt die kombinierten Ergebnisse zurück. Beachten Sie, dass Sie die Spaltennamen und Tabellennamen entsprechend Ihrem spezifischen Datenbankschema anpassen müssen.

Das obige ist der detaillierte Inhalt vonWie führe ich UNION-Abfragen mithilfe des aktiven Datensatzes von CodeIgniter aus?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n